Conditions

older adults with subthreshold depression

Interventions

The intervention group watch videos on SPSRS for about 3 minutes at a time, once a day, 5 times a week, for 3 weeks. The control group watch videos on YouTube for about 3 minutes at a time, once a day

Inclusion criteria

Inclusion criteria: Selection criteria were inpatients 65 years of age or older, with a Geriatric Depression Scale 15 score of 5 or higher, with sufficient cognitive ability to understand the content and purpose of the study, and who were able to give written consent prior to participation in the study.

Exclusion criteria

Exclusion criteria: Exclusion criteria were those with visual or hearing impairment at a level that would cause problems in daily living, and those who were assessed by The Mini-International Neuropsychiatric Interview as having had a major depressive episode in the past 2 weeks.

Design outcomes

Primary

MeasureTime frame
The primary outcome is the change in Geriatric Depression Scale 15 after the 3-week intervention.

Secondary

MeasureTime frame
Secondary outcome is the change in Medical Outcome Study 8-Item Short-Form Health Survey after 3-week intervention.
